Wheel alignment is very encouraged just after aquiring a auto’s tie rod or tie rod ends changed. This is due to the fact that the relative adjustment of the auto’s tie rods specifically dictates a front end’s toe environment. This location in alone is incredibly crucial that you steering effectiveness, and tire wear in general.

A auto´s tie rods also Enjoy a pivotal part in setting and protecting front-end alignment. The “toe“, or inward/outward orientation of the car´s entrance tires, is manipulated by adjusting an auto or truck´s tie rods.
